USAGE SUMMARY

The phrase "inertial dynamics" is correct and usable in written English.
It can be used in contexts related to physics, engineering, or mechanics, particularly when discussing the motion of objects and the forces acting upon them. Example: "The study of inertial dynamics is crucial for understanding how vehicles respond to acceleration and deceleration."

FAQs

How can I properly use "inertial dynamics" in a sentence?

Use "inertial dynamics" to describe the study or behavior of objects in motion under the influence of inertia, as in, "The analysis of "inertial dynamics" is crucial in aerospace engineering."

What fields of study commonly involve "inertial dynamics"?

"Inertial dynamics" is frequently applied in fields like aerospace engineering, mechanical engineering, and physics to understand the motion and forces acting on objects.

What is the difference between "inertial dynamics" and simple dynamics?

"Inertial dynamics" specifically focuses on the role of inertia in dynamic systems, while dynamics, in general, encompasses all forces affecting motion, including non-inertial forces.

Is there a context where I shouldn't use the term "inertial dynamics"?

Avoid using "inertial dynamics" when discussing systems at rest or situations where inertia is not a primary factor influencing the motion.
